Global Infrastructure As Code Market Report Overview

The Global Infrastructure As Code Market was valued at USD 1243 Million in 2025 and is anticipated to reach a value of USD 7083.3 Million by 2033 expanding at a CAGR of 24.3% between 2026 and 2033. Growth is driven by enterprise-wide cloud-native modernization, DevSecOps integration, multi-cloud automation, and policy-based infrastructure management that reduce deployment errors while accelerating application delivery across regulated and digital-first industries.

Segmentation Analysis

By Type

Declarative Automation Leads Enterprise Adoption

Declarative Infrastructure as Code remains the leading segment with an estimated 46% market share because it enables predictable infrastructure provisioning, simplified lifecycle management, and stronger scalability across hybrid cloud environments. Organizations increasingly prefer declarative models for policy enforcement, automated reconciliation, and reduced configuration drift. Agent-Based solutions represent the fastest-growing segment as enterprises require continuous monitoring, intelligent orchestration, and real-time infrastructure visibility across distributed environments. Adoption of Agent-Based deployments has increased by nearly 32% within complex enterprise cloud architectures.

Imperative Infrastructure as Code continues serving organizations requiring detailed execution control and customized workflows, particularly in legacy enterprise environments. Agentless platforms remain strategically important for organizations seeking lower deployment complexity and simplified infrastructure integration without installing endpoint software. Technology vendors are expanding declarative automation capabilities, strengthening agent intelligence through AI integration, and investing in platform interoperability to address increasingly complex enterprise cloud ecosystems. These investment priorities continue shifting enterprise preference toward automated, policy-driven infrastructure management with greater operational consistency.

Recent Developments in the Global Infrastructure As Code Market

  • June 2025 HashiCorp announced general availability of the Terraform AWS Provider 6.0 with enhanced multi-region capabilities and workflow improvements, enabling broader AWS service integration and more efficient infrastructure lifecycle management. Business impact: faster enterprise cloud deployment. 

  • July 2025 Amazon Web Services released Account Factory for Terraform (AFT) version 1.15.0 for AWS Control Tower, expanding enterprise automation capabilities and supporting new deployment configurations across AWS environments. Business impact: improved governance and standardized cloud provisioning. Source: (AWS Documentation)

  • July 2026 Amazon Web Services introduced automatic customization re-application for AWS Control Tower Account Factory for Terraform when accounts move between organizational units, eliminating manual intervention and reducing configuration drift. Business impact: stronger operational consistency across enterprise cloud estates. Source: (Amazon Web Services, Inc.)

  • June 2026 HashiCorp enhanced HCP Terraform with project-level run tasks, enabling organizations to apply centralized security and compliance guardrails across groups of workspaces while reducing manual administration. Business impact: improved governance and scalable enterprise policy enforcement. Source: (HashiCorp Developer)
